Discussion
WordPress File Groups Plugin 'fgid' Parameter SQL Injection Vulnerability
The File Groups plugin for WordPress is prone to an SQL-injection vulnerability because it fails to sufficiently sanitize user-supplied data before using it in an SQL query.
Exploiting this issue could allow an attacker to compromise the application, access or modify data, or exploit latent vulnerabilities in the underlying database.
File Groups 1.1.2 is vulnerable; other versions may also be affected.

Exploit / POC
WordPress File Groups Plugin 'fgid' Parameter SQL Injection Vulnerability
Attackers can use a browser to exploit this issue.
The following example URI is available:
http://www.example.com/wp-content/plugins/file-groups/download.php?fgid=-1 AND 1=BENCHMARK(5000000,MD5(CHAR(87,120,109,121)))
